what are the main differences between emerald tree boas and green tree pythons?

Besides chondros being better?? J/K, lol!! Seriously though, boas give live birth, and pythons lay eggs. In all, I would say that is the biggest difference. I also think that generally speaking chondros are smaller as adults. Emaralds are a New World species, and Tree Pythons are Old World.

If you look at enough pictures there is a big difference in the looks. Chondros have smaller heads and snouts with heat pits located within the scales. Emeralds have heat pits located between the labial scales. From what I have heard Emeralds are much less comfortable on the ground, where as it is not that abnormal for a chondro to utilize floor space in it's cage from time to time.

I believe baby color phases are different for each as well. I've never seen a yellow baby Emerald.

Emeralds are bigger and stockier than Chondros especially Basins which can get to over twice the weight of the average chondro. With a bigger head and longer teeth emeralds also can do more damage when they bite.

I keep a number of both and would say that Emeralds are a bit more touchy when it comes to husbandry especially WC.

I've never heard of a yellow baby emerald either though some emeralds are born green and I've never heard of a hatch ling chondro that was green. You get more color variation in chondros as well, blues, high yellows ETC ETC.
